@Neven

As you said the One you already have is a bit weak for you and you would like to have something more powerful. So the Era100 imho won’t be a good upgrade because it sounds very similar to the One. Not really more powerful. 
I use a Move 1 for about three years and I‘m very happy with it. This one IS more powerful and also I mainly use it as a fixed speaker but like the option to take it with me sometimes in the garden or outside listening to some music while fixing my bike. 
If you don’t need the option to use Move as a Bluetooth „input“ or cabled line in via adapter (what Move 2 can do), I think Move 1 with the actual price is a very good deal. 

Sonos Roam is a nice small speaker to take with you everywhere, but it’s limited in sound by its size. So at home I just use it in the bathroom to listen to radio.
